logo

Output ec9407db61d938c9e0be7213bf70d295101335decfa537522ba74d09af321d2c:1

value
1839270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c3420797a013670940a99ee265aec512f1a0ee OP_EQUAL
address
3NBTCGkqyMck2uVJiYrLeKaYsXyBXE7efY
transaction
ec9407db61d938c9e0be7213bf70d295101335decfa537522ba74d09af321d2c